DUTIES:
Assist outside customers from the court system to schedule incarcerated individuals to appear for court hearings via video or telephone. Assist attorneys in the visitation of their clients. Assist Presentence Investigation Officers in meeting with incarcerated individuals to complete pre-sentence investigations as assigned. Coordinate meetings between DHHS representatives and incarcerated individuals, to include visits between the incarcerated individual and their child(ren) as ordered by the court. Provide notary service to incarcerated individuals as needed. Prepare American Correctional Association (ACA) files and assists the Administrative Programs Officer II during ACA audits. Provide facility tours. Serve as a backup to the Administrative Programs Officer II in the preparation of litigation reports.
Requirements / Qualifications
Minimum Qualifications: Associate degree in public or business administration, accounting, or any discipline related to the work assigned. One year of experience in administrative, business management or technical support work including collecting and interpreting statistical, financial, program, or administrative data; or interpreting laws, rules, regulations, and processes. Experience may substitute for education on a year-for-year basis.
Preferred Qualifications: Experience working in the corrections field or a criminal justice setting. At least two years demonstrated experience in office administration, analyzing data, as well as planning and organizing information. Experience in records retention management. Experience using Microsoft Office.
Other: Applicants accepting a job offer must pass the following pre-employment exams in this order: medical exam, and at a randomly announced time, pass a drug test. Once at the Staff Training Academy, must successfully complete the fully paid NE Corrections Training Program.
Knowledge, skills and abilities
Knowledge of: office management and record keeping methods and practices; administrative report preparation practices; federal and State laws and regulations governing work assigned.
Ability to: interact with immediate supervisor and senior managers, employees, and the public to gain their cooperation and to establish work relationships; formulate and recommend modifications to operational directives to attain agency goals; coordinate the activities necessary to arrange various conferences, hearings, and meetings; apply management practices, techniques, and methodologies to assigned activities; collect, assemble, and analyze facts and draw conclusions to recommend solutions to problems; identify and interpret program-administrative requirements, policies, and regulations to provide guidance and advice; organize and present facts and opinions to managers and groups; learn the structure, functions, goals, and policies of the employing agency.
